Hi guys, I have a SV650s k6 and i want to change my front indicators from stock to mini arrows. The problem is i dont have a clue on how to do it and i'm on a very tight budget. Does anyone know if there's a website that can show how or a downloadable instructions.
I'd appreciate any help even if it's just advice. ![]() |

Pointy/curvy? Fairing/naked?
On my pointy (S, not naked), if you stand infront of the bike & look back at it (so you're looking at the front of the indicators), there's a wee little screw that holds the indicator in place. Undo that, pull it out, job jobbed. P.S. You'll probably find you also need some Motrax Indi spacers too, but don't hold me to that. |
